Hi,

Right when email invitations are sent, I get an error for "bad" emails. For example:

Sending invitations...
Email to XYZ (xyz@xyz.com) failed. Error message: SMTP Error: The following recipients failed: xyz@xyz.com: : Recipient address rejected: Domain not found

or

Sending invitations...
Email to XYZ (xyz@xyz.com) failed. Error message: SMTP Error: The following recipients failed: xyz@xyz.com: : Recipient address rejected: Recipient address rejected: User unknown in relay recipient table


The problem is that these failures are NOT recorded by LimeSurvey. So it looks like the bounce feature is quite limited and much of the work still has to be done manually. Is this correct?

I'm on Version 2.63.1+170305 (I know, but that's what my University has deployed right now.) Is this any better in a more recent version?

To me this looks like a problem with your SMTP server. So of course there is no "bounce".

Bounce is when the email server on the other side sends an error message, but in your cases it seems like the emails don't even make it out of your server.
